Business Valuation

Definition

The impact of AI and machine learning refers to the significant changes brought about by the integration of artificial intelligence and machine learning technologies in various sectors, including their influence on decision-making processes, efficiency improvements, and innovation. These technologies reshape how businesses operate, especially in areas like intellectual property valuation, by providing advanced data analysis capabilities and predictive modeling that enhance accuracy and insight.

5 Must Know Facts For Your Next Test

  1. AI and machine learning can enhance the accuracy of intellectual property valuations by analyzing large datasets to identify trends and value drivers.
  2. These technologies allow for real-time assessments, improving the timeliness and relevance of valuation reports in dynamic markets.
  3. AI can automate routine tasks involved in the valuation process, freeing up human analysts to focus on more strategic aspects of their work.
  4. Machine learning algorithms can continuously improve their predictive capabilities as they process more data over time, resulting in more refined valuation models.
  5. The impact of AI extends beyond just efficiency; it also fosters innovation by enabling new business models and opportunities in the intellectual property landscape.

Review Questions

  • How do AI and machine learning technologies specifically enhance the accuracy of intellectual property valuations?
    • AI and machine learning improve the accuracy of intellectual property valuations by processing vast amounts of data more effectively than traditional methods. They can identify patterns and correlations that may not be visible through manual analysis. This allows for a more comprehensive understanding of market dynamics, leading to better-informed valuations that reflect current trends and economic conditions.
  • What role does predictive analytics play in leveraging AI for intellectual property valuation, and how does it change decision-making?
    • Predictive analytics plays a crucial role by utilizing historical data to forecast future trends related to intellectual property assets. By integrating this with AI technologies, businesses can make data-driven decisions that are more informed and timely. This shift in decision-making transforms traditional valuation practices into proactive strategies that anticipate market movements and potential risks.
  • Evaluate the long-term implications of AI and machine learning on the future landscape of intellectual property valuation.
    • The long-term implications of AI and machine learning on intellectual property valuation could be profound. As these technologies continue to evolve, they will likely create more sophisticated valuation methods that can adapt to changing market conditions. This evolution may also lead to greater accessibility for smaller firms who can leverage AI tools without extensive resources. Ultimately, this could democratize the field, increase competition, and foster innovation while raising new challenges around data privacy and ethical considerations.
